FAQ
Common WordPress questions
Is WordPress right for my business?
WordPress powers 43% of the web for good reason — it is flexible, well-supported, and manageable by non-technical staff. For most business websites and content-driven sites in Nigeria, it is the right choice. For complex web applications, we recommend a custom build instead.
Can I update my site myself after you build it?
Yes. We train you on the WordPress admin panel so you can add pages, update content, and manage products yourself. For anything more complex, we are on retainer.
My existing WordPress site is slow and hacked. Can you fix it?
Yes. We clean malware infections, remove malicious plugins, harden security, and optimise performance. We then set up proper monitoring so it does not happen again.
How long does a WordPress build take?
A standard business website takes 3–5 weeks. A WooCommerce store with Nigerian payment integration takes 5–8 weeks. Custom functionality adds time.
